I think the mu chromatic approach sounds modern because the added 2 is often not in the traditional scale you'd use with a secondary dominant. Like with C - A/C# - Dm you'd most likely use D *harmonic minor* (with Bb) during the A. But Aadd2/C# has *B natural*. (Although classical has the D melodic minor scale containing B, in practice a classical piece would never _sustain B_ over an A chord in D minor.)
